LPL Financial (LPLA) Scheduled to Post Earnings on Wednesday

LPL Financial (NASDAQ:LPLAGet Free Report) will be announcing its earnings results after the market closes on Wednesday, October 30th. Analysts expect LPL Financial to post earnings of $3.73 per share for the quarter. Individual that wish to register for the company’s earnings conference call can do so using this link.

LPL Financial (NASDAQ:LPLAG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 25th. The financial services provider reported $3.88 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.66 by $0.22. The business had revenue of $2.93 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.89 billion. LPL Financial had a return on equity of 52.14% and a net margin of 8.91%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 18.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$3.94 EPS. On average, analysts expect LPL Financial to post $16 EPS for the current fiscal year and $19 EPS for the next fiscal year.

About LPL Financial

LPL Financial Holdings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ides an integrated platform of brokerage and investment advisory services to independent financial advisors and financial advisors at enterprises in the United States. Its brokerage offerings include variable and fixed annuities, mutual funds, equities, fixed income, alternative investments, retirement and 529 education savings plans, and insurance.
